Man bags 1 month imprisonment for pick- pocketing

A Kado Grade 1  Area Court, Abuja, on Monday sentenced an 18-year-old man, Ogodo Nnaemezie, to one month imprisonment for pick-pocketing.
 
The convict, a labourer, who lives at Gwagwalada, Abuja, had pleaded guilty to the offence. 
The Judge, Alhaji Abubakar Sadiq, who handed down the verdict, however, gave the convict an option of N5, 000 fine. 
 
Earlier, the prosecutor, Insp. Simon Ibrahim, told the court that the case was reported at the Utako Police Station, Abuja, on March 16 by one Godson Onukwe of Jabi Park, Abuja.
Ibrahim said the accused was caught committing the offence at Gidan-wanka, Jabi Park.
 
Ibrahim said the offence contravened Section 96 of the Penal Code.
